Eat at Nikkyu

Do you like your cooked Japanese food to be excessively salty? Do you like your rice to be cooked with too much water and therefore be sticky and soft? Do you like having to ask for refills of tea and for a plate to mix wasabi and soy sauce for dipping (even though you are seated near the service station so the staff can see your empty glass and lack of dishware each time they pass by your table)? Do you enjoy having to wait for a table and to pay your bill even though it is a quiet restaurant on a Sunday evening and there appears to be plenty of staff on-shift?

You should eat at Nikkyu Sushi on Main St.
